Senior Product Development Engineer, FastenMaster Division

OMG Inc. is a leading manufacturer of fastening products and technologies for the commercial roofing and construction industries worldwide. Headquartered in western Massachusetts, OMG is an equal opportunity employer prioritizing the safety of our employees and customers. The company values integrity, teamwork, diversity, trust, respect, commitment, and a passion for excellence. OMG is a global company operating manufacturing facilities in Massachusetts, Illinois, and Minnesota.

Position Overview

The OMG Product Development and Innovation team is focused on developing compelling and innovative new products, and improving our existing products to better meet the needs of professional contractors and building specifiers in the markets we serve. Reporting to the Product Development Engineering Manager, you will use a gated development process and Six Sigma tools. This highly rewarding position is responsible for whole project management -- from ideation to launch, including timeline management, cross-organization communications, and overall team management.

Key Responsibilities
  • Promote Safety as our #1 priority for all OMG employees and our customers.
  • Work with Project Manager and Product Manager to define project scope
  • Conduct jobsite Gemba with product manager to define Job To be Done (JTBD), identify current practices, existing IP and unmet needs
  • Proactively manage Intellectual Property Strategy from Provisional to Final Patent
  • Apply NPD process tools to identify and prioritize CTQ targets
  • Identify and acquire internal and external development resources to generate potential solutions that meet project demands
  • Bring potential solutions through NPD stage gate process while continuously narrowing focus toward best potential concepts for commercialization
  • Design experiments and testing process to evaluate effectiveness of potential concepts
  • Ensure manufacturability of selected solution for commercialization
  • Minimize solution cost / maximize potential value and profitability
  • Define and conduct FMEA to maximize potential success of new product
  • Work with Quality team to develop and implement QAQC process.
  • Work with Manufacturing Engineering team to develop a manufacturing transition strategy
  • Manage 2-4 Projects concurrently
  • Measures of success are: patents, bill of materials (BOM) accuracy and final design performance
